Output 9d093bbb310f0cb9ad0e6de34e499fcfbcdb058ee23315b7c4792d7ca08edfe6:3

value
1366215
script pubkey
OP_0 OP_PUSHBYTES_32 51bfd5556b81ffca5a79aa1756f26d8cf3067d2dd0c98f2a39291ce851751ac5
address
bc1q2xla24tts8lu5kne4gt4dund3nesvlfd6ryc723e9ywws5t4rtzs2wfu6a
transaction
9d093bbb310f0cb9ad0e6de34e499fcfbcdb058ee23315b7c4792d7ca08edfe6
confirmations
28570
spent
true